How to Come across a good Family Lawyer


A good family lawyer understands that each individual and every case is distinctive. He or she understands that every case deserves high top quality legal representation regardless of how much or how small is at issue. There are many methods to look for a family lawyer who can assist you solve the challenging and stressful issues that you are facing appropriate now. But discovering the appropriate 1 is far more important. So where do you start?


It is possible to truly start your search for a qualified family lawyer by asking some pals or your family who knew of someone or from those that have been into the exact same scenario and had been able to overcome the method fairly well. You can also do this by soliciting for referrals specially if you are searching for a cheap divorce. This will support you financially and emotionally. And you can find diverse factors that you need to take into account when finding one.


When choosing your lawyer you look at the various aspects. They're chosen on account of their reputation, experience as well as the number of years they've been inside the organization. You may possibly also must look at what do they specialize in, is it divorce, child custody, spousal subsidy etc. This will make certain that your case or situation is going to be correctly addressed. Make specific to find a lawyer who has the abilities and experience you need to meet your objectives. With a little bit of effort and luck, you can locate one that can meet your goals while providing you with successful legal representation.
